Not using Mountain Lion? Get notifications with Chrome and Safari, too
The desktop notifications fun isn’t limited to Mountain Lion! If you’re using Chrome 20 or Safari 6 (or later, if you’re reading this from the future), your browser now supports desktop notifications for Remember The Milk:

Enabling desktop notifications
Just log in and go to the ‘Settings’ screen in your account, then click the 'Reminders’ tab. You’ll see the new Desktop Notifications option; once you turn this 'on’, just follow the browser’s prompt to give Remember The Milk permission to send notifications.

Important note: Both Mountain Lion and Chrome/Safari desktop notifications require Remember The Milk to be running in your browser, but you always have it open in one of your tabs, right? Right?!
